Filing History

IRS 990 filing history for Edwin D Hourigan Trust showing financial trends over 8 years of public records:

Over 8 years of IRS 990 filings (2011–2020), Edwin D Hourigan Trust's revenue has declined by 2.9%, moving from $10K to $10K. Total assets decreased by 0.3% over the same period, from $120K to $120K. Total functional expenses rose by 1.9%, from $6K to $6K. In its most recent filing year (2020), Edwin D Hourigan Trust reported a surplus of $4K, with revenue exceeding expenses. The organization holds $1 in liabilities against $120K in assets (debt-to-asset ratio: 0.0%), resulting in net assets of $120K.

IRS 990 forms are annual information returns that most tax-exempt organizations must file with the IRS. These forms provide detailed financial information including revenue, expenses, assets, liabilities, and compensation of officers.
